2. Students introduce the author of this article according to the collected information. (Students exchange collected data; The teacher added. )

(Projection introduction: Leopold (1887— 1948) is a famous American environmentalist. He is an enthusiastic observer, a keen thinker and a literary master with profound attainments. The Yearbook of Shaxiang is his most famous work. In this collection of natural essays and philosophical papers, Leopold described colorful nature with lyrical literary techniques and expressed his interest in advocating nature in a lyrical way. In his article, we can see the power of nature, and we can also see his lament that human beings have ravaged nature for their own interests. This book is known as the "Green Bible" because of its beautiful writing and profound thoughts.

2. Finish the second task: read carefully the beautiful sentences that you just drew in the process of reading the text and savor them. Then, in groups of four, explore and think about the reasons why they think they write well. Students read the taste aloud, think and communicate, and answer the questions after about 5 minutes. The teacher illustrates the key sentences that the students didn't mention, and guides the students to appreciate them. )

(Projection shows examples and appreciation. )

○ 1 "They turned around along the winding river, ... whispering to every beach, just like whispering to an old friend after a long separation. They meander in swamps and meadows and say hello to every newly melted puddle and pond. " -These words not only describe vivid images, but also show the cleverness, cuteness and enthusiasm of geese, and show the author's love for geese!

○2 "As soon as we touched the water, our new guests cried. The water they spilled made the fragile cattail shake off the winter." This sentence compares the wild goose to a "guest", which shows the author's love for wild geese; The verb "thump" and "shake off" are vividly used, which vividly shows that the return of geese indicates that everything has got rid of the cold in winter and warm spring has arrived.

○3 The verbs "hovering", "flapping slowly" and "sliding quietly" in the fourth paragraph are also well used! -These verbs not only describe the specific process of geese landing, but also describe the elegance of geese movements, which has left a profound impact on people and also shows the author's careful observation.

○4 "In this annual migration, the whole continent gets a poem with wildness that falls from the sky in March"-the author compares the chirping of geese in migration to "a poem with wildness", which not only writes the loveliness of geese, but also expresses their love for them.
